Chris: I have a story for you. In the SFP, I received a size 32 from Hans W, and proceeded to try and tie a fly. The jaws spit it out. I tried to bow out but Hans sent me another. I was trying to get it in my vise when it slipped and disappeared when I knocked a couple of things over when I was looking for it. Thought this is it then Tony Spezio sent me one, and I finally was able to tie a fly for the SFP. A couple of weeks later I was cleaning around my desk when I thought I saw a glint of gold. I got out a magnifying glass and there in the rug was a size 32 hook. Rather than risk trying to grab it. I took the round magnet I keep on my tying desk, and used it to pick the hook up. When I turned it over to get the hook off, I found two hooks instead of one. The magnet had been on my desk the night I'd dropped the second hook and it had been sitting on it for two weeks. I passed one on to one of the tyers in the swap who had bent the one he had gotten. The other one is sitting in a small clear plastic box at my local fly shop.
